    iPod touch (3rd generation) features a 3.5-inch (diagonal) widescreen multi-touch display and 32 GB or 64 GB flash drive. You can browse the web with Safari and watch YouTube videos with Wi-Fi. You can also search, preview, and buy songs from the iTunes Wi-Fi Music Store on iPod touch.
    The iPod touch (3rd generation) can be distinguished from iPod touch (2nd generation) by looking at the back of the device. In the text below the engraving, look for the model number. iPod touch (2nd generation) is model A1288, and iPod touch (3rd generation) is model A1318.

  • Is it possible to retrieve a registration key for a hard copy of iWork 06? Moved and cannot locate disc, and replaced the computer it was originally installed on. When I transferred the program to new Macbook, the reg key apparently didn't transfer.

    Is it possible to retrieve a registration key for a hard copy of iWork 06? Moved and cannot locate disc, and replaced the computer it was originally installed on. When I transferred the iWork from original Macbook Pro to new Macbook Pro, the reg key apparently didn't transfer. Any ideas?

    Do you still have access to the old MacBook Pro? If so, you can transfer the license by copying the com.apple.iwork.plist from Macintosh HD > Library > Preferences to the same location on the new Mac. Note that this IS the main HD Library, not your user library. I have found that these files are not moved during setup or migration.

  • HT1212 Old ipod, can not get it to connect with itunes & i no longer have the computer it was once synced to. It will not allow me to do anything but turn it off & on.

    Old ipod, can not get it to connect with itunes & i no longer have the computer it was once synced to. It will not allow me to do anything but turn it off & on.

    Place the iOS device in Recovery Mode and then connect to your computer and restore via iTunes. The iPod will be erased.
    iOS: Wrong passcode results in red disabled screen                         
    If recovery mode does not work try DFU mode.                        
    How to put iPod touch / iPhone into DFU mode « Karthik's scribblings        
    For how to restore:
    iTunes: Restoring iOS software
    To restore from backup see:
    iOS: Back up and restore your iOS device with iCloud or iTunes
    If you restore from iCloud backup the apps will be automatically downloaded. If you restore from iTunes backup the apps and music have to be in the iTunes library since synced media like apps and music are not included in the backup of the iOS device that iTunes makes.
    You can redownload most iTunes purchases by:
    Downloading past purchases from the App Store, iBookstore, and iTunes Store        
    If problem what happens or does not happen and when in the instructions? When you successfully get the iPod in recovery mode and connect to computer iTunes should say it found an iPod in recovery mode.
